Samsung Workers Plan Extensive Strike Amid Discontent Over Profit Sharing

Unionized workers at Samsung are preparing for an extended 18-day strike, a significant escalation following last year’s historic labor protest, which marked the first strike by Samsung employees in 50 years. The situation stems from a growing frustration among employees regarding their compensation in light of the company’s substantial profits. As first reported by Wccftech, the union is demanding bonuses amounting to 15 percent of Samsung’s annual operating profit, which equates to roughly $30 billion.
